Hi Arno,
I love the color scheme and the clean look of your design. It feels fresh. Here are a few suggestions if you don't mind -
Somehow the navigation links at the top look out of place. With the saturated blue color and the underlines, they look too much like the default link style. Perhaps change them to CSS buttons, or at least remove the underline (or change to a different style).
The headers in the 3 boxes could stand out a bit more. Maybe a different font that's also in the modern clean style.
The icon for "webdevelopment" feels small compared to the other two.
As others have already mentioned, I think the design would look even better with the drop shadows and gradients toned down a bit.
